## Ownership

Hey plugin folks — the cron drift investigation lives in this repo under `drift-probe/`. If your plugin schedules jobs through the Tickwright API and you're seeing runs land minutes late, this is where we're tracking it. Feel free to attach your timing logs to the tracker, but please don't ship workarounds that re-pin the scheduler clock; that's made things worse twice already. Questions, repro cases, and theories about the skew all go to the person named below.

named custodian: Belius Casath Ulaix Sorius

## Gatelock: rate limiting (excerpt)

Gatelock enforces token-bucket limits per service identity at the edge. Bursts are tolerated up to bucket capacity; sustained overage returns 429 with a retry hint. Internal batch callers get a separate tier. Limits are static this quarter; dynamic tuning is deferred. Current constants for the sync's review follow.

tuning table, kahof-faweg:
QUOTAS = {
    "holath": 1,
    "zorix": 1,
    "holix": 2,
    "ulaix": 10,
}

- [ ] **Step 7: Breaker override escrow.** After sealing the signing keys for the Tallgrove upstream API circuit breaker, confirm the support team can force the breaker open during a full outage. The override bundle lives in the sealed escrow drawer and is useless without its unlock phrase. Two ceremony witnesses must initial this step before proceeding. The escrow bundle is decrypted with the recovery passphrase that follows.

vault phrase of kahip-kahop = holath-quenmir

## Deployment

Alertfold deduplicates on-call pages before they reach your plugin's notify hook. Plugins run in the same pod as the deduplicator, so deploys are coupled: when you ship a plugin update, the Alertfold release pipeline rebuilds the combined image and rolls it across the paging fleet. No manual steps are needed beyond merging. Your plugin receives the runtime settings below at startup; the current values are as follows.

settings of fafog-haduf:
ZORIX_PIN=4648
ZORIX_METRICS_HOST=metrics.zorix.paliqsys.corp
ZORIX_LOG_LEVEL=info
ZORIX_TENANT=druix